Identifying the Purposes of Local Government

Curated and Reviewed by Lesson Planet
This Identifying the Purposes of Local Government lesson plan also includes:
  • Project
  • Join to access all included materials

Students work cooperatively in small groups to identify the purposes of local government. They review the five broad purposes of local government and match the services of government to the appropriate purpose.
